Microsoft Azure uses Alveo™ U250 data center accelerator cards to enable FPGA-as-a-Service (FaaS), also known as Azure FPGA Runtime Platform -NP series, to deliver seamless migration of applications between on-premises and cloud. This acceleration platform uses Dynamic Function eXchange with 2 Reconfigurable Partitions (DFX-2RP) and delivers standardized DMA (XDMA) plus advanced features including AXI-Slave connection to user's data mover.
